1 Karen Flowers, District Judge (retired) Karen Flowers was born and raised in Connecticut. She received an AA degree from Hartford College for Women (now part of the University of Hartford), a BA in economics from Brandeis University, and a Law Degree from UNL. Between graduating from college and going to law school she taught 8th mathematics and 9th grade algebra at Middlebrook Junior High School in Trumble, Connecticut for two years. In 1970 she moved to Lincoln where her husband got a job at UNL. Mrs. Flowers was a traffic analyst for the Nebraska Department of Roads for one year before entering law school. After graduating from law school, she practiced law in Lincoln for 20 years. Her area of focus was family law. Mrs. Flowers was appointed to the District Court bench in 1996 and retired at the end of During that time she and her husband raised two boys, Andy and Mike. Mrs. Flowers is a member of the Nebraska State Bar Association and was Chair of the House of Delegates in She is a past president of the Lincoln Bar Association, the Nebraska District Judges Association and a former Master of the Bench in the Robert Van Pelt Inns of Court. Prior to her appointment to the bench she served on the Board of Directors of a number of civic organizations including Family Service Association, Planned Parenthood, and Leadership Lincoln. Mrs. Flowers was a member and past president of Lincoln Lancaster County Commission on the Status of Women.

Todd Lancaster, Nebraska Commission on Public Advocacy Todd Lancaster was born in La Mesa, California. He graduated from the University of California, San Diego in 1994 with a Bachelor s degree in Political Science. He then attended the University of Nebraska, Lincoln - College of Law and graduated in After law school, Mr. Lancaster started at the Madison County Nebraska Public Defender s Office. He was with the Madison County Public Defender s Office until September of At the Public Defender s Office, he tried numerous cases and assisted in the capital murder trial of Jose Sandoval who was involved in the U.S. Bank Murders in Norfolk in After he left the Public Defender s Office, Mr. Lancaster entered private practice with McGough Law, based in Omaha. During his time with McGough Law he continued to practice almost exclusively in the area of criminal law in Nebraska state courts and in federal courts in Nebraska and Iowa. Mr. Lancaster started with the Nebraska Commission on Public Advocacy in May of The Commission can be appointed to represent defendants in all Nebraska counties for serious crimes of violence such as murder and sexual assault. Mr. Lancaster has tried close to 40 felony cases to a jury in state and federal courts. 10 of these have been cases in which the State alleged murder in the first degree. In three of these cases, the State had sought the death penalty and the cases went through the guilt/innocence phase, the aggravating/mitigating circumstance phases, and the sentencing in front of a panel of three judges. In two out of three times, his clients were given a life sentence instead of a death sentence. Many of his cases have involved forensic science issues such as DNA, fingerprints, firearm and toolmark analysis, gunshot residue, blood spatter and others.

Ziemer, Lincoln Airport Authority Police Robert Ziemer began his law enforcement career in 1978 as a deputy sheriff for the York County, Nebraska Sheriff s Department, the same year he received his Bachelor of Arts degree in Physical Education and Health from Doane College, Crete, Nebraska. In April of 1979 he was hired by the Lincoln Police Department and served the city of Lincoln until September 30, He began his second career as the Chief of Police for the Lincoln Airport Authority on October 1, During his career with the Lincoln Police Department Robert functioned in many roles including; uniformed street patrol officer, motorcycle officer, field training officer, uniformed street sergeant, Special Weapons and Tactics officer, Field Training Program Supervisor, Academy Director, Range Master, and Special Weapons and Tactics Assistant Commander. As Chief of Police for the Lincoln Airport Authority, Robert manages a workforce of 45 people including law enforcement officers, communications operators, and customer service representatives. The Lincoln Airport Authority Police Department provides law enforcement services for the over five thousand acres of Airport Authority property including the Airport Terminal and Airport Industrial Park. Additionally, LAAPD officers provide law enforcement support to the Transportation Security Administration at the passenger screening checkpoints.

Wade Knaap, Detective Constable with the Toronto Police Service (Retired) Wade Knaap is a part time faculty member in the Forensic Science Program at The University of Toronto Mississauga where he teaches forensic science and forensic identification related courses. Prior to this, Mr. Knaap was a Detective Constable with the Toronto Police Service and a Forensic Identification Specialist in the Forensic Identification Services Unit. Mr. Knaap regularly lectures and conducts workshops at universities, colleges and conferences throughout Canada and the U.S. on forensic development techniques and topics. He is a past president of The Canadian Identification Society and a former chair of The Ontario Police College Forensic Advisory Board. Mr. Knaap is a serving member of the Forensic Advisory Committee at the University of Ontario Institute of Technology and teaches a course in Applied Methods of Forensic Identification at the University of

5 Windsor. He has been published numerous times in The Journal of Forensic Identification, Identification Canada and The RCMP Gazette regarding forensic identification concepts. Mr. Knaap was also a contributing author in the text book Crime and Measurement: Methods in Forensic Investigation. In 2010 he was honored as a Distinguished Member of The International Association for Identification. Since 2012, Wade has been the editor of Identification Canada. In , Wade Knaap was the recipient of The Al Waxman Award for Excellence in the Field of Forensic Identification. Director Pam Zilly, Nebraska State Patrol Crime Laboratory Pam Zilly has worked in the field of forensic sciences for the past 36 years, ever since graduating from the University of Nebraska with a Bachelor s Degree in Criminal Justice. She started her career in the latent fingerprint discipline at the Lincoln Police Department, where her duties also included photography, maintenance of the breath alcohol equipment and forensic document examination. In 1987 Mrs. Zilly moved to the Nebraska State Patrol Crime Laboratory to focus her energies in the area of forensic Document Examination. Gradually she began to shift her focus from analytical work to supervision and management duties, and was ultimately promoted to the position of Crime Laboratory Director in Mrs. Zilly has attended numerous trainings in the area of forensic laboratory management, and is a graduate of the University of California-Davis Forensic Science Laboratory Leadership and Management Certificate Program. Mrs. Zilly is also an active member of the American Academy of Forensic Sciences, the International Association for Identification, and the American Society of Crime Laboratory Directors. Inv. David Sobotka, Jr., Omaha Fire Investigation Unit Investigator David Sobotka has been employed by Omaha Fire Department for 13 years and is currently assigned to the Fire Investigation Unit. Current duties include the investigation of all fires within the Omaha city limits, which the department averages over 600 structure fires per year. Currently a certified Law Enforcement Officer in the State of Nebraska, Sobotka is also a Certified Fire and Explosion Investigator through the National Association of Fire Investigators (NAFI) and the International Association of Arson Investigators (IAAI). Sobotka has attended numerous classes on firefighting/ems, Hazardous Materials, fire investigation, and law enforcement; including attendance at the National Fire Academy in Emmetsburg, MD, and currently holds an AS degree in Fire Science. Sobotka works closely with other local agencies, such as the Omaha Police Department, Douglas County Sheriff s Office, ATF, private investigators, insurance companies, and the Douglas County Attorney s office, in the arrest and prosecution of suspected arsonists and any other related crimes. Sobotka began his firefighting career when he joined a volunteer fire department at the age of 16. Sobotka then became a member of the Omaha Fire Department in 2003; progressing from Firefighter, Fire Apparatus Engineer, to Fire Investigator. In August 2013, David became a fire investigator graduating from the Omaha Police Department Training Academy becoming one of a few Omaha Firefighters certified as an Omaha Police Officer. Sgt. Todd Kozelichki, Omaha Police Department Sgt. Todd Kozelichki is 20 year law enforcement veteran. He started out at the Douglas County Sheriffs Office in While there, he worked on the Road Patrol and within the Court Services Bureau at the Douglas County Courthouse. In 1998, Todd was hired by the Omaha Police Department. Since being at the police department, Todd has worked in several units, to include Uniform Services, the Southeast Metro Unit (gangs, street level narcotics, and prostitution investigations), and the Burglary and Robbery Units. He spent eight year within the Homicide Unit and the Cold Case Unit. In June 2010, Todd was promoted to Sergeant, and is now working within the Gang Unit. In reference to the Westroads Mall / Von Maur shooting investigation, Todd was one of the main investigators on this case. He was initially assigned to lead the crime scene investigation, and then conducted several follow-up interviews and assignments relating to suspect Robert Hawkins' background. Due to his work on this case, Todd received the Jack Swanson - Lloyd Grimm, 2007 Omaha Crimestoppers Officer of the Year award. He is also part of a team of instructors who travel abroad to instruct on the happenings and aftermath in reference to the Von Maur shooting. Todd is also certified as a Nebraska secondary education teacher with a specialty in Mathematics, along with being a certified law enforcement instructor through the Omaha Police Department and the Nebraska Law Enforcement Training Academy in Grand Island, Nebraska. Todd has provided instruction to the Omaha Police Department, the Omaha Fire Department, and other agencies in reference to crime scene investigations and death / homicide investigations. Todd has also taught similar courses between 2004 and the present at Hamilton College, ITT Technical Institute and Metropolitan Community College.

Mike Barry, Lincoln Police Department Michael Barry was commissioned as a Lincoln Police Officer in 1997 and is currently assigned to the Special Victims Unit as an Investigator. His primary case load involves the investigation of sexual assault of children and felony child abuse. Michael received a B.S. degree from Nebraska Wesleyan in Sociology and Anthropology with a minor in Criminal Justice and Spanish. His career in law enforcement began with uniform patrol during various shifts throughout the city of Lincoln. He has been on the Lincoln Metro Clandestine Lab Team since Michael did two 3 year rotations in the Special Victims Unit from His investigative position was made non-rotatable in 2012 and was selected for polygraph school in Michael attended polygraph school in Austin, TX through the Department of Public Safety. He has conducted a combination of 78 criminal and pre-employment polygraphs for the Lincoln Police Department.

Steven Berry, Lincoln Police Department Steve Berry was commissioned as a Lincoln Police Officer in 2005 and again in 2011 after a brief stint away from law enforcement. He is currently assigned as an Investigator with the Gang Unit. The primary role of his current assignment tasks him with identification and interdiction of gang members, collecting and disseminating gang intelligence, and working in cooperation with federal, state, and other local agencies to make proactive gang related cases. Steve received a B.A. in Psychology from the University of Nebraska- Lincoln in 2004 and is a United States Marine Corps veteran. Steve has attended multiple gang trainings including the Las Vegas Metropolitan International Gang Conference in 2015 and the National Gang Crime Research Center Conference, also in The majority of Steve s law enforcement career has been as a patrol officer, primarily working 3 rd shift, and he was assigned to the Gang Unit in 2014.
